1927 - 2019
Mr. Max Carter Bingham, age 92 of Clemmons, passed away Friday, June 7, 2019. He was born January 4, 1927 in Randolph County to the late Fred and Jessie Johnson Bingham. Max graduated from Clemmons School, where a friendship with the three Phelps boys led him to his wife of 67 years, Ruth. Max...
